Crossed Arms Front Leg Kick
Description
The crossed arms front leg kick is a dynamic warm up drill that kicks the legs forward while the arms cross over the chest. The combination challenges balance and opens the hamstrings.

Crossed Arms Front Leg Kick Instructions
- Stand tall with feet hip width apart and arms crossed over the chest.
- Brace the core and keep the chest tall.
- Lift one straight leg forward and up to about hip height.
- Aim to keep the leg straight without losing posture.
- Lower the leg back to the floor with control.
- Repeat with the opposite leg.
- Maintain the crossed arms throughout the set.
- Continue alternating leg kicks for the full duration.

Crossed Arms Front Leg Kick Benefits
- Stretches the hamstrings dynamically.
- Builds balance and single leg control.
- Warms up the hips before lifting or sport.
- Engages the quads and core.
- No equipment needed.
- Excellent dynamic warm up move.
Crossed Arms Front Leg Kick Muscles Worked
- Hip flexors
- Quadriceps
- Hamstrings
- Core
